Learn how to identify, locate, and repair a radiator leak with various methods and products find out the signs of a radiator leak, how to use radiator stop leak, and when to replace your radiator Leak at the connection between the radiator valve and radiator if your radiator is leaking at the nut that connects the valve to the radiator, first try tightening the nut
Grip the body of the radiator valve with a pair of water pump pliers and use an adjustable spanner to tighten the nut
If this doesn't fix the issue, you'll need to drain the radiator and apply some ptfe tape to the olive. Fixing a radiator leak promptly is crucial for maintaining your vehicle's performance and longevity Cracked radiator body cracks cannot be repaired as effectively as other leak causes
Sealants only work to slow the leak for a short term, so replacing the radiator is the only reliable solution
It may be best to consult a professional in this instance, as cracks in the radiator body may suggest pressure issues elsewhere in the system.
